17. Sensor
Fig. 39 Correct position of sensor
During maintenance and replacement of the sensor, it is
important that the sealing cap is fitted correctly on the sensor
housing.
Tighten the screw holding the clamp to 3.7 ft-lbs (5 Nm).

Warning
Before replacing the sensor, make sure that the
pump is stopped and that the system is not
pressurized.
